Output e20614848517c8a14f5d8c19a4c873e2bc62d265e5bb554d1a71ba02cdbcae1d:0

value
1165904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a181ad344302231e352668e6d3f4656e91efc50 OP_EQUAL
address
3CpbEn1ynDV1DLdHEWHwu4m4KufGsbx6vV
transaction
e20614848517c8a14f5d8c19a4c873e2bc62d265e5bb554d1a71ba02cdbcae1d
confirmations
333462
spent
true